When does the southern hemisphere have the warmest climate?

The southern hemisphere generally experiences its warmest climate during its summer months, which are from December to February. Given its position in relation to the tilt of the Earth's axis, these months correspond to their summer season.

Why is the tropic zone generally the warmest place earth?

The tropic zone is generally the warmest place on Earth due to its location between the Tropic of Cancer and the Tropic of Capricorn, where the sun's rays strike more directly throughout the year. This direct sunlight results in higher temperatures and less seasonal variation compared to other latitudes. Additionally, the tropics experience longer daylight hours during the year, contributing to consistently warm conditions. The combination of these factors creates an environment that is typically hot and humid.
